R. Adam has authored 14 papers that have received a total of 401 indexed citations.
This includes 11 papers in Materials Chemistry, 11 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 4 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. The topics of these papers are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(11 papers), Copper-based nanomaterials and applications (8 papers) and ZnO doping and properties (5 papers). R. Adam is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(11 papers), Copper-based nanomaterials and applications (8 papers) and ZnO doping and properties (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, France and Iran. R. Adam's co-authors include M. Willander, Omer Nur, Xianjie Liu, Sami Elhag and Mahsa Pirhashemi and has published in prestigious journals such as RSC Advances, Nanotechnology and Journal of Solid State Chemistry.
